Amid a fierce standoff between the White House and major news outlets over the effectiveness of recent strikes on Iran, new intelligence from a source who maintains regular contact with Iranian officials confirms that the attacks were largely a failure.

The source told Whale Hunting that Iran retains 80% of its centrifuges and 100% of its uranium stockpile, a direct contradiction to the Trump White House's public statements of "obliteration" and "complete success." This new information gives weight to the reports from CNN and The New York Times.
